Chimney fire at home in Haymarket displaced 2 residents, cat

From Prince William County fire and rescue: 

On, Friday, December 16th, at 9:20 a.m., fire and rescue units were dispatched to a structure fire in a single-family home located in the 4200 block of Misty Ridge Drive in Haymarket.

Upon arrival, fire and rescue crews observed fire in the chimney with extension to the home’s exterior. As fire and rescue units initiated extinguishment of the fire, firefighters assisted in the evacuation of a disabled resident.

No injuries reported.

Two adults were home at the time of the fire. Red Cross was on scene to assist the displaced residents and their pet cat.

According to the Fire Marshal’s Office, preliminary damages are estimated at $40,000.

The Building Official was on scene and has posted the home unsafe. Prince William County Department of Fire and Rescue Chief Kevin McGee urges residents to be vigilant when using alternative heating methods by following these simple safety tips to keep you and your loved ones safe and warm:

— Install wood burning stoves following manufacturer’s instructions or have a professional do the installation.

— Keep fireplaces and woodstoves clean.

— Clean annually by a certified chimney specialist.

— Keep area around fireplace and woodstove clean and free of debris, decorations and flammable materials.

— Always use a metal mesh screen with fireplaces.

— Keep air inlets open on woodstoves and fireplaces.

— If closed, inlets cause creosote buildup and lead to chimney fires.

— Use fire resistant materials, like walls and floors, around woodstoves.

— NEVER leave a fire unattended in a fireplace.

— Extinguish fire before leaving the house or going to bed.

— ALWAYS remove ashes in a covered metal container and store at least 10 feet away from your home and any nearby buildings.
